2013 Turkey Watch Report with Governors Vetoes

/ Categories: Research, Budget Turkeys, Taxes, Budget/Approps
UPDATED: With Vetoes The 2013 Florida TaxWatch Turkey Watch Report identifies $106.8 million in Budget Turkeys. This annual Report identifies appropriations that appear in the budget at the last minute, bypassing the legislatively-established competitive process and receiving little or no public review. This years Report highlights 107 projects that deserve extra consideration for veto by the Governor.

2013 Taxpayer Independence Day

/ Categories: Research, Taxes, Taxpayer Guide
Sunday, April 21, is Florida Taxpayer Independence Day 2013, as estimated by Florida TaxWatch. On that day, Floridians are finally earning money for themselves–not for the tax collector. This symbolic date assumes that every dollar earned since January 1 goes to pay federal, state, and local tax obligations.
